机构地区:[1]桂林医学院附属医院肝胆胰外科,桂林541001
出 处:《国际外科学杂志》2014年第12期834-836,共3页International Journal of Surgery
摘 要:目的 建立小鼠异位心脏移植模型,为进行移植免疫研究提供动物模型.方法 昆明(KM)小鼠50只,随机分供、受体两组,借鉴大鼠异位心脏移植Ono式模型经验,并加以改良,将供体升主动脉、肺动脉分别与受体的腹主动脉和下腔静脉行端侧连续吻合.结果 成功建立了小鼠腹腔异位心脏移植模型,实验成功率为84% (21/25).供、受体的手术时间分别为(11.0±l.0)min和(60.0 ±2.0)min.结论 熟练掌握显微外科技术后,可以成功建立小鼠异位心脏移植模型.Objective To establish a mouse model of heterotopic heart transplantation and construct an animal model for the study of transplantation immunity.Methods According to the surgical procedures of Ono's pattern in mice cardiac heterotopic transplantation model,50 Kunming mice were divided into donors and recipients randomly.The donor heart aorta and the recipient ventral aorta,the donor pulmonary artery and the recipient inferior caval vein,were anastomosed by using the end-to-side suture technique respectively.Results The mouse model of heterotopic heart transplantation was established successfully with a success rate of 84% (21/25).The average time of donor operation and recipient operation was (11.0 ± 1.0) min and(60.0 ± 2.0) min respectively.Conclusions In the base of mastering the technique of operation facility,the model of mice heart heterotopic transplantation would be established successfully.
